加入收藏 | 设为首页 | 会员中心 | 我要投稿 PHP编程网 - 钦州站长网 (https://www.0777zz.com/)- 智能办公、应用安全、终端安全、数据可视化、人体识别!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

MsSql存储优化:触发器应用与性能提升实战指南

发布时间:2026-03-04 11:00:14 所属栏目:MsSql教程 来源:DaWei
导读:  在数据库优化中,触发器是一种强大的工具,能够自动执行特定操作,例如数据验证、日志记录或数据同步。然而,不当使用触发器可能导致性能问题,因此需要合理设计和应用。创意图AI设计,仅供参考  在MsSql中,触

  在数据库优化中,触发器是一种强大的工具,能够自动执行特定操作,例如数据验证、日志记录或数据同步。然而,不当使用触发器可能导致性能问题,因此需要合理设计和应用。


创意图AI设计,仅供参考

  在MsSql中,触发器可以用于实时维护数据一致性。例如,在更新订单表时,可以通过触发器自动更新库存表,确保库存数量始终准确。这种机制虽然提高了数据完整性,但也可能增加额外的计算负担。


  为了提升性能,应避免在触发器中执行复杂的查询或长时间运行的操作。可以将部分逻辑拆分到应用程序层,或者通过异步处理方式减少对主事务的影响。尽量减少触发器的嵌套调用,以防止递归导致的性能下降。


  监控和分析触发器的执行效率是优化的关键步骤。可以使用SQL Server Profiler或动态管理视图(DMV)来跟踪触发器的执行时间、调用频率及资源消耗。通过这些数据,可以识别出性能瓶颈并进行针对性优化。


  另外,定期审查和重构触发器代码也是必要的。随着业务需求的变化,某些触发器可能变得冗余或低效。及时清理不必要的触发器,并优化现有逻辑,有助于保持系统的高效运行。


  站长个人见解,合理利用触发器可以增强数据库的功能性,但必须结合性能考量进行设计。通过精细化管理和持续优化,可以在保证数据一致性的前提下,实现更高效的MsSql存储系统。

(编辑:PHP编程网 - 钦州站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章